Asus X99-A motherboard, second-hand E5-2673v4, running 20 threads at one per core

Code:
[Work thread May 20 12:44] Resuming primality test of M54082397 using FMA3 FFT length 2880K, Pass1=384, Pass2=7680, clm=2, 20 threads
[Work thread May 20 12:44] Iteration: 2779000 / 54082397 [5.13%], ms/iter:  1.223, ETA: 17:26:02
I suspect everything fits in the 50MB L3 on this chip, and so the iteration time is extremely stable; the clock speed is 2.4GHz on each core.

If I switch to 10 threads

Code:
[Work thread May 20 12:40] Iteration: 2825000 / 54082397 [5.22%], ms/iter:  2.131, ETA: 30:20:29
but I guess two 10-thread workers would need to hit RAM and be significantly slower.

I'll run mprime on this machine for a few days until the extra memory required to run 40 gnfs-lasieve4I16e jobs at once arrives

For comparison, the i7-5820K on the same board managed 3.29ms/iter for p=56778599

Huh, that's a weird one.

What exponent is running on the second worker? Assuming both are 2880K FFT size, they should both fit with a little spare place into 50 MiB, as 2880*8 gives about 22.5 MiB of L3 cache needed for the test.

I've asked paulunderwood to run a few throughput benchmarks on the 3990X. Many thanks for that.
I attached graphs of the results.

The first one is normalized throughput benchmark from size 64K to 19200K for 1, 2, 4, 8, 16, 32, and 64 workers, all using 64 cores in total. Normalization was done by the following formula [normperf = throughput * ln(FFT size) * FFT size / clock speed (4,1 GHz)]. You can see performance drops, which show when the cache runs out.

The second graph is a zoomed-in part of the first one so that the differences can be seen better.

ZIP file contains the values used, as well as original graphs, in an Excel spreadsheet.


Manual data analysis showed some weird behaviour. Due to not having enough time now, they will be mentioned in another post.
